If a franchisee loses the Beggars Pizza manuals, what are they required to do?

Beggars_Pizza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

Type of Fee Amount Due Date Remarks
Manual Replacement Fee $250 When billed. Payable if you lose or misplace any part of the Manuals and we replace it.

Source: Item 6 — OTHER FEES (FDD pages 9–11)

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Beggars Pizza's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, if a franchisee loses or misplaces any part of the manuals, they are required to pay a Manual Replacement Fee. This fee is $250 and is due when billed by Beggars Pizza. This fee covers the cost for Beggars Pizza to replace the lost or misplaced manuals.
